The crossed paralyses: Millard-Gubler, Foville, Weber & Raymond-Cestan brainstem syndromes mnemonic

Millard-Gubler: Facial palsy and contralateral hemiparesis.

Foville: Facial palsy, conjugate gaze paralysis, and contralateral hemiparesis.

Weber: Oculomotor palsy and contralateral hemiparesis.


Raymond-Cestan: Internuclear ophthalmoplegia and contralateral hemiparesis.
